zebra/.github/workflows
Conrado Gouvea bc4194fcb9
ZIP-221/244 auth data commitment validation in checkpoint verifier (#2633)
* Add validation of ZIP-221 and ZIP-244 commitments

* Apply suggestions from code review

Co-authored-by: teor <teor@riseup.net>

* Add auth commitment check in the finalized state

* Reset the verifier when comitting to state fails

* Add explanation comment

* Add test with fake activation heights

* Add generate_valid_commitments flag

* Enable fake activation heights using env var instead of feature

* Also update initial_tip_hash; refactor into progress_from_tip()

* Improve comments

* Add fake activation heights test to CI

* Fix bug that caused commitment trees to not match when generating partial arbitrary chains

* Add ChainHistoryBlockTxAuthCommitmentHash::from_commitments to organize and deduplicate code

* Remove stale comment, improve readability

* Allow overriding with PROPTEST_CASES

* partial_chain_strategy(): don't update note commitment trees when not needed; add comment

Co-authored-by: teor <teor@riseup.net>
2021-08-23 14:17:33 +00:00
..
cd.yml Update to google-github-actions/setup-gcloud in workflows (#2533) 2021-07-27 12:13:04 -04:00
ci.yml ZIP-221/244 auth data commitment validation in checkpoint verifier (#2633) 2021-08-23 14:17:33 +00:00
coverage.yml Stop using the wrong name for the coverage action (#2453) 2021-07-07 11:36:54 -03:00
docs.yml Use Swatinem/rust-cache@v1 (#2291) 2021-06-15 11:36:33 +10:00
manual-deploy.yml Update to google-github-actions/setup-gcloud in workflows (#2533) 2021-07-27 12:13:04 -04:00
regenerate-stateful-test-disks.yml Merge pull request #2601 from ZcashFoundation/dconnolly-patch-1 2021-08-11 12:15:22 -04:00
release-drafter.yml Specify v5, not 'latest' 2021-01-29 17:38:46 -05:00
test.yml Update to cache v10 (#2644) 2021-08-19 17:33:22 +00:00
zcashd-manual-deploy.yml Update to google-github-actions/setup-gcloud in workflows (#2533) 2021-07-27 12:13:04 -04:00